©The voice mail icon flashes if there is at least one new message in your
mailbox (p. 48). During playback, it will be displayed.
©The line status icons function as follows. (If your unit is registered to
KX-TG2000B, “BE*” and “Ki” will not be displayed.)

Off (invisible)
The line is free.
On The line is being used.
Flashing
A call is on hold. The Automated Attendant System or
Answering System is responding to a call (p. 40, 42).
Flashing quickly
A call is being received.
©The battery icon indicates the battery strength (p. 10).
©“ [ - ] ” is displayed in the standby mode if the station unit is not registered
to the base unit. At registration the unit will be assigned the extension
number, and the number will display in square brackets in the standby
mode (p. 12, 13).
The display shows the dialed number, call status, programming options
and directory items etc. If you subscribe to a Caller ID service, caller
information will be displayed (p. 29).
Backlit LCD display
While the AC adaptor is connected (AC power mode, p. 9) and you are
operating the unit, the display will remain lit. However, while the unit is
powered by the battery (battery power mode, p. 10), the display will not
light.
